We can search in a binary search tree by tracing a path starting … WebJan 10, 2024 · Since you are interested in binary search, you can always assume, that your input array is sorted and take it from there. ... Now if you want to test this method, you should always test the edge cases (first element, last element, element not found) aside from any random element. This way you are sure, that your code works in both directions ... WebFeb 12, 2009 · Here some practical examples where I have used binary search: Implementing a "switch () ... case:" construct in a virtual machine where the case labels are individual integers. If you have 100 cases, you can find the correct entry in 6 to 7 steps using binary search, where as sequence of conditional branches takes on average 50 … modifying group policy

A binary tree is a tree in which every node has at most degree two. Conventionally, a descendant of an internal node in a binary tree is called the left child or the right child of the respective internal node (the names are obvious if you think of the graphical representation of a tree). A node of degree two must have one of each ...

WebJul 23, 2024 · Now there can be edge cases, like the last occurrence can be the last element which means for the searching key no greater key exists. If the last occurrence is not the last element then the least greater element will be the next immediate right element of the last occurrence . Below is the implementation:
